Overview Neurosin-OD Injection
Synthetic vitamin B12, administered via Neurosin-OD Injection, addresses vitamin B12 insufficiency. Essential for cellular growth, replication, hematopoiesis, and protein/tissue synthesis, B12 also mitigates anemia, fatigue, and peripheral paresthesia. Administer Neurosin-OD Injection precisely as directed, adhering strictly to prescribed dosage and accompanying instructions. Consistent, scheduled administration maximizes therapeutic efficacy. This injection may complement dietary adjustments and other therapies; consult resources on B12-rich foods. Generally well-tolerated, Neurosin-OD Injection rarely elicits adverse reactions. However, inform your physician of all concurrent medications, as some may interfere with B12 absorption. Prior to treatment, disclose any pre-existing conditions such as Leber's hereditary optic neuropathy, hepatic impairment, or renal dysfunction to ensure treatment safety.

How Neurosin-OD Injection works:
Vitamin B12 injections, such as Neurosin-OD, replenish depleted B12 stores, aiding in the management of specific anemias and neurological conditions.
